FRUIT COCKTAIL CAKE RECIPE | ALLRECIPES



Fruit Cocktail Cake Recipe | Allrecipes image

Very moist and fruity cake, no oil added, quick and easy. Especially delicious when served with whipped cream. Originally submitted to ThanksgivingRecipe.com.

Provided by Cyndi

Categories     Desserts    Cakes    Holiday Cake Recipes

Yield 1 - 9 inch square cake

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 cup all-purpose flour
1 cup white sugar
1 egg
1 teaspoon baking soda
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 (16 ounce) can fruit cocktail
½ cup packed brown sugar

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Lightly grease one 9x9 inch square baking pan.
  • Combine the flour, white sugar, egg, baking soda, vanilla and undrained fruit cocktail. Mix until blended. Pour batter into the prepared pan and sprinkle the top with the brown sugar.
  • Bake at 350 degrees F (175 degrees C) for 40 minutes or until golden brown and firm.

FRUIT COCKTAIL SALAD RECIPE: HOW TO MAKE IT - TASTE OF HOME: FIND RECIPES, APPETIZERS, DESSERTS, HOLIDAY RECIPES & HEALTHY COOKING TIPS



Fruit Cocktail Salad Recipe: How to Make It - Taste of Home: Find Recipes, Appetizers, Desserts, Holiday Recipes & Healthy Cooking Tips image

"Convenient canned fruit and instant pudding mix streamline preparation of this refreshing medley," reports Karen Buhr from Gasport, New York. This shortcut salad can also be served as a sweet satisfying dessert for diabetics.

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Lunch

Total Time 15 minutes

Prep Time 15 minutes

Cook Time 0 minutes

Yield 12 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 6

2 cans (15 ounces each) fruit cocktail in juice
1 can (20 ounces) unsweetened pineapple tidbits, drained
1 can (11 ounces) mandarin oranges, drained
1 tablespoon lemon juice
1 package (1 ounce) instant sugar-free vanilla pudding mix
2 medium firm bananas, sliced

Steps:

  • In a bowl, combine the fruit and lemon juice. Sprinkle with pudding mix. Stir gently for 1 minute or until mixture is thickened. Fold in bananas. Refrigerate until serving.

EASY STEWED FRUIT RECIPE | JAMIE OLIVER FRUIT RECIPES
A few spoonfuls of simple seasonal fruit works a treat on everything from brekkie to Sunday roast!
From jamieoliver.com
Total Time 15 minutes
Cuisine https://schema.org/LowLactoseDiet, https://schema.org/GlutenFreeDiet, https://schema.org/VeganDiet, https://schema.org/VegetarianDiet
Calories 69 calories per serving
    1. Chop up all the fruit, discarding any stones.
    2. Place the fruit in a pan. If using rhubarb, peel the ginger and finely grate it into the pan. Add the sugar – I usually add 3 heaped teaspoons to rhubarb and 2 heaped teaspoons to any other fruit, but just taste as you go along and add more if you think it needs it (please be careful when tasting as it gets really hot). Add 2 tablespoons of water and cook on a medium heat with the lid on.
    3. Once the fruit has softened, remove the lid and let the liquid reduce – you want to end up with a fairly thick consistency.
    4. Serve over cereal, yoghurt, pancakes, granola, muesli or even with roast pork!

KUMQUAT BREAKFAST MARTINI COCKTAIL RECIPE
27/12/2021 · This recipe from bar star Naren Young uses an innovative one. A riff on the iconic Breakfast Martini created by London bartender Salvatore Calabrese, Young’s recipe calls for making a kumquat marmalade, cooking the fruit into the classic jam-like treat along with a variety of spices, and incorporating a heaping bar spoon of the marmelade into the drink.
